your all saying that classes are useful because thats what we have now and the points brought up as to why there useful is valid, but theres no reason jobs cant be improved to better represent how classes are. if they get rid of classes they could make jobs more flexible by adding a new system, like be able to equip 5 abilities from any job or something simple like that.
on another note i would like to say once and for all that i hate everyone who says "if you dont like it you dont have to use it" there is no game design behind giving the player every single thing they could want without structure based on that logic.
like lets give people an auto level up quest thats repeatable as much as you want. and i gurantee there will be people saying if you dont like it you dont have to use it. just kuz its there doesnt mean its good for the game
though classes isnt bad and im good either way, i just think jobs can replace classes with alittle more work
While I think that Jobs can and will eventually replace classes the solution isn't to make them flexible like classes currently are. Otherwise what is the point of having the jobs in the first place?
Jobs need to be unique from one another, Not everyone needs to cast stoneskin or Sentinel...nor should it be encouraged to have everyone devolve into a "jack of all trades" class.
Thats my opinion at least.
